Description We have obtained evidence from 1 3C NMR measurements that the CN~ ion in the elastically ordered phase of KCN is misoriented slightly with respect to the orthorhombic b axis. This misorientation varies randomly over the lattice, averaging to zero on a macroscopic scale. The misorientations are manifested through small-angle CN" reorientations which contribute to the spin-lattice relaxation time Tx of the °C nuclei, via dipolar interactions and chemical shift anisotropy.
